After updating the system (Feisty) via the update-manager on 2007-06-12,
the system slows down after working 20 minutes and comes unresponsive,
may be because a memory leak in some on the packages updated.  Inclusive
after changing to a console using Ctlr-F1, typing a key takes an
eternity.

The symptom comes using Firefox or Inkscape or Komodo Editor. Before the
update the system was run normally. This looks like a virus in Windows
Systems, where the system slows down because of the virus activity.

The packages updated are:

file 4.19-1ubuntu2 4.19-1ubuntu2.1
libmagic1 4.19-1ubuntu2 4.19-1ubuntu2.1
libexif12 0.6.13-5build1 0.6.13-5ubuntu0.1
libpng12-dev 1.2.15~beta5-1 1.2.15~beta5-1ubuntu1
libpng12-0 1.2.15~beta5-1 1.2.15~beta5-1ubuntu1
libgd2-xpm 2.0.34~rc1-2ubuntu1 2.0.34~rc1-2ubuntu1.1
